  • Hummingbird soars to new heights at Goodwood

    Published 15/10/25

    On Sunday the Plymouth High School for Girls F24 electric racing car team travelled to Goodwood for the International Finals. We are delighted to announce that the team achieved a new record, with Hummingbird covering a distance over 40 mile and achieved a top 10 position, nationally. A huge congratulations to the Team and big thanks to the staff who supported the trip and our sponsor, Becton Dickinson.
